Charles CROSS and Rose FLOOD arrived in Australia on the "Neptune" as convicts in 1790

  1. - Sarah CROS S married Humphrey TAYLOR and John HORTON
  2. - Mary Ann CROSS married William DOUGLASS
  3. - Sussannah CROSS married Anthony RICHARDSON and Richard Lionel ROSE
  4. - Edward CROSS married Margaret STUBBS
  5. - Christopher CROSS married Mary Ann PECKHAM and Mary Ann LITTLE
  6. - Elizabeth CROSS married Richard HAYES

Together they have over 30000 descendants.


CHARLES CROSS was born in Somerset, England about 1749. He was convicted in 1787 at Somerset for stealing a silver buckle and received a 7 year sentence . He was transported to Australia aboard the ship "Neptune" and arrived in Sydney Cove on the 26th June 1790 as part of the Second Fleet.

Charles Cross and Rose Flood married at Rose Hill (now Parramatta) on the 21st November 1790. They had 6 children; Sarah (1791), Mary Ann (1793), Susannah (1795), Edward (1799) Christopher (1801) and Elizabeth (1805). Charles became a farmer in the Windsor (NSW) district and at times had large acreages of land at Wilberforce and Cattai. In 1831 Cross, described as a resident of Lower Pitt Town, was granted 50 acres on Little Cattai Creek known as Wheeny Farm. His sons Christopher and Edward were also each granted 50 acres adjoining their father's grant. Charles Cross died on 13 October 1835. Rose died on 4 November 1836. They are buried in adjoining plots at St Johns Cemetery, Wilberforce NSW.
